As teens begin to explore their identities and beliefs, they may need some guidance to keep them on the Christian path. Many find youth ministry to be a valuable part of growing up because they learn to communicate with their peers and participate in their church community. 1. Spiritual Growth

Each individual has a unique spiritual journey. While spiritual growth can be a complicated process, having a guiding light outside the family can be helpful. Youth group sessions allow your teen to share their thoughts with teachers and peers, participate in activities and service projects, and grow as a Christian. 

2. Needed Support

youth ministry Anchorage AKIf your child is going through a turbulent time, they shouldn’t have to go it alone. While you're always there for your children, sometimes it's helpful to get out of the house and spend valuable time with friends and a leader who can counsel them in times of need. These years aren't easy for anybody, but youth ministry offers much-needed support to help teens grow into strong, spiritual adults.

3. Engagement at Church

Teenagers don't always look forward to attending church services, but a Christian youth group makes it more enjoyable. They'll look forward to meeting up with their leaders and fellow group members, and feel a sense of accomplishment as they become more engaged in the church community.

4. No Fear of Judgement

If your child is struggling with school, they may be hesitant to discuss the problem with you. When teens have a leader and peers they can rely on, they're more likely to talk about school problems and receive the needed encouragement to seek help without fear of judgement. A youth group leader offers a compassionate, objective view when your child needs help getting ahead, whether in their relationship with Jesus or everyday life.
